Always begin by inquiring about their licensing and insurance. Understanding whether or not the contractor is licensed to work in your area is crucial. An unlicensed contractor might not adhere to native codes and regulations, which can lead to authorized issues down the road. Insurance is equally necessary; make sure they have liability and worker’s compensation protection to guard you from any unexpected accidents or mishaps.

Past work and references are excellent indicators of a contractor's capabilities. Ask to see their portfolio and up to date initiatives. A contractor with a range of successfully accomplished tasks demonstrates versatility and experience. It’s additionally wise to request references from earlier purchasers. A reliable contractor may have no problem providing this info.

Understanding the contractor’s experience with your specific sort of project is important. Some contractors focus on residential tasks, while others could concentrate on industrial work. If your project requires unique expertise, you should ensure that the contractor can meet those calls for effectively.


It's also beneficial to ask about the project timeline. Knowing when the contractor can start and how long they anticipate the project to last allows you to set realistic expectations. A good contractor will present a detailed timeline, including milestones and deadlines, to keep the project on track.




Don't overlook the importance of communication. Inquire about how regularly you can expect updates and what methods they use for communication. A contractor that values open dialogue will doubtless hold you informed at every stage, which is vital on your peace of mind.


Discussing the budget early on might help keep away from misunderstandings later. Request an in depth estimate that breaks down labor, material, and other costs. It's crucial to grasp the contractor's fee schedule. Knowing when funds are due and what milestones set off each payment can safeguard against potential disputes. A reputable contractor will present readability on this aspect, allowing you to plan your finances accordingly.


Inquire concerning the subcontractors they use. Many general contractors incessantly make use of subcontractors for specialized duties. It’s essential to grasp who shall be working on your project and whether or not they are certified professionals. Furthermore, ask about how the contractor manages these subcontractors to make sure high quality and consistency.

Lastly, don’t forget to debate warranty and aftercare companies. A credible contractor should stand by their work and offer a warranty for supplies and labor. Understanding what occurs if points arise after project completion can help present additional reassurance.


Being diligent in your questioning can prevent from potential headaches down the road. Taking time up front to ask the right questions can forestall miscommunication and unrealistic expectations, ultimately leading to a smoother project experience.


Always keep in mind that finding the best contractor isn't just about affordability; it's about worth. Contractors who could seem cheap may minimize corners or lack experience, leading to additional prices afterward. Investing time into vetting potential candidates pays off in the long run, guaranteeing the quality and integrity of your project.

Research critiques and testimonials on-line, go to websites like Yelp and Google Reviews, and ask for references from previous purchasers. Contact these references to inquire about their experiences, specializing in aspects like communication, quality of work, and adherence to timelines.


What ought to be included in the contract?


A detailed contract should define the scope of labor, timelines, cost schedules, supplies to be used, permits required, and any warranties or guarantees. Having clear terms helps shield both parties and ensures everyone understands their obligations.

Request detailed estimates from a number of contractors to match pricing. Look for a breakdown of costs somewhat than a lump sum, and don’t routinely choose the lowest bid; contemplate the contractor's status, experience, and high quality of supplies as properly.


What is the estimated timeline for my project?


A reliable contractor should present a practical timeline primarily based on the project scope. Ask for a schedule that features milestones and contingencies for unexpected delays. Clear timelines assist handle your expectations and guarantee accountability.

How will you handle permits and inspections?


A competent contractor must be conversant in local constructing codes and liable for securing needed permits. They should also coordinate inspections as required, guaranteeing compliance with laws throughout the project.


What is your communication type throughout a project?


Effective communication is essential. Ask the contractor how typically they'll provide updates, who your main point of contact might be, and their preferred technique of communication. Clear communication helps stop misunderstandings and keeps the project on track.

What happens if there are adjustments or delays during the project?


Inquire about their coverage for change orders and handling delays. A professional contractor could have a transparent course of for navigating unforeseen points, ensuring that you're knowledgeable and concerned in decision-making.


Do you supply any warranties for your work?


Most reputable contractors will provide warranties on each workmanship and supplies used. Ask for specifics about the guarantee phrases, length, and what it covers, as this displays their confidence in the high quality of their work.
